To set honest expectations: a straightforward home or car lockout commonly falls in roughly the $75–$175 range, lock rekeying often runs around $20–$50 per cylinder plus a service or trip fee, and new lock installation varies with the hardware you choose. These are estimates only — real pricing depends on the time of day, your location, the type and condition of the lock, and the parts required. A 24 hour emergency locksmith call at 3 a.m. naturally costs more than the same job mid-afternoon, and high-security hardware costs more than a basic knob.

What's the difference between rekeying and replacing a lock?

Rekeying changes the internal pins so your old keys stop working and a new key takes over, while keeping your existing hardware — it's the cheaper choice when your locks are in good shape. Replacing makes sense when the hardware is worn, outdated, or you want to upgrade to higher security. We're happy to recommend which fits your situation.
